About LightInTheBox Holding Financial Statements

LightInTheBox Holding stakehol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as LightInTheBox Holding's revenue or net income,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although LightInTheBox Holding invest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. For example, changes in LightInTheBox Holding's assets and liabilities are reflected in the revenues and expenses on LightInTheBox Holding's income statement, which ultimately affect the company's gains or losses. The market value of LightInTheBox Holding is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of LightInTheBox that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of LightInTheBox Holding's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is LightInTheBox Holding's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because LightInTheBox Holding's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ect LightInTheBox Holding's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between LightInTheBox Holding's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if LightInTheBox Holding is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, LightInTheBox Holding's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
